Tempus Fugit Spirits is a small private company based in the United States specializing in the production of high quality spirits. The goal is to procure and recreate historical distillates to satisfy the most demanding connoisseurs. The founders, John Troia and Peter Schaf are both historians, and both are passionate distillate experts


They're constantly looking for products used in cocktail recipes handed down by Jerry Thomas and other pioneers of mixology, striving to reproduce them as faithfully as possible and thus creating products such as Gran Classico, Avion d'Or and a series of bitters and vermouth of old times.
